High Altitudes: Warm up when climbing beyond 3500m

As you reach middle-hill lodge places such as Namche Bazaar (3,440 m) the mountain air starts to bring the temperature down to 10C-15C (50F-59F) outside. Thus, from being too warm it becomes a comfortable chill and the air crisp. In addition, the high elevation temperature will vary rapidly as you gain altitude.

So, you will need warm clothes for above 3,500 meters. Also, the Namche Bazaar climate means the winds can also be quite cold. So, you will also need lots of warm layers for the trek. Also, the Nepal mountain accommodation requires a very good sleeping bag you will get a good night sleep.

In fact, the cold at high altitude is an integral part of the true mountain adventure. So, you can sit in the warm dining hall and eat good food with fellow trekkers. And this easy measure goes a long way towards making evenings more comfortable.

Location / AreaDaily Temperature (Around) | Night Temperature (Around)Observation
Namche Bazaar (3,440 m)10-15C  |  2-8CRather cool days, cold nights
Higher Camps5-12C | 0 to -5 CCold, fresh, crisp air

Freezing Nights: How Chilly Do Mountain Teahouses Get After Sunset in October?

On clear days the nights fall rapid once the sun is shrouded by the peaks. The night time in mountain areas can be reported to be extremely cold in October. In addition, the night temperature at Everest Base Camp or Thorong Phedi at 4,000m+ often goes down to freezing point to -5C to -10C (23F to 14F).

Rain Record: Does it Ever Rain During trekking in Nepal in October?

October has been a very dry month in terms of humidity levels historically. As a result, the rainfall in Nepal October is less. Also, days of long continuous rains are very uncharacteristic.

Hence, the dry trekking conditions keep the surface of the main trails firm and safe, while the monsoon retreat ensures settled weather with barely a drop of rain. So, you'll have beautiful clear views along the trails and no worries of having to walk through heavy rain. Also, a lightly overcast afternoon could bring a bit of 'thumbs' cloud over the valleys for a while, but it will tend to blow away quickly.

In fact, the reduction in rainfall also ensures that the stone steps and forest tracks remain firm and less slippery. So, you can trek, with great confidence and value the scenery truly. Also, it is not a surprise for many trekkers to choose October.

MonthAverage Rainfall (mm)  | Rainy Days (Approx.)Trail Conditions
September100-150  |  8-10Wet and muddy
October30-60  | 3-5Mostly dry
NovemberLess than  10 | 1-2Very dry and stable

Snow Conditions: Will You Encounter Snow on High Passes during October?

Deep snow on the main walking routes in mid-October is highly unusual. Therefore, the probability of a heavy snow on the paths is extremely low. Furthermore, the snow fall in Nepal in October is 'higher' regions.

Colorful prayer flags fluttering at Cho La Pass with panoramic views of surrounding snow-capped Himalayan peaks under a clear autumn sky.
Cho La Pass (5,420 m) – Prayer flags decorate the iconic Cho La Pass, where trekkers are rewarded with breathtaking views of  the spectacular Himalayan mountain range connecting the Everest Base Camp and Gokyo Lakes treks.

So, the magnificent mountain peaks are beautiful under fresh white snow. And this makes the excellent scenery without snow on the path. Therefore, if crossing high passes (more than 5000m), it may need micros pikes for the occasional icy patches. In addition, the high mountain pass safety is generally good with stable weather conditions.

In fact, October is generally the month when passes such as Larkya La, Thorong La & Chola are not covered with deep snow. Hence, I apt time to do the crossing with right permits & preparations. And that is why October is favorite for majority of trekkers.

PassChance of Snow in OctoberTypical Conditions  | Trail Impact
Larkya LaLowPossible light dusting  |  Occasional icy patches
Thorong LaLowLight snow possible  |  Good with microspikes 
Chola PassVery LowMinimal snow  |  Dry and stable

Flight Reliability: Fewer Delays for Mountain Airports Like Lukla in October

The morning flights are always calm and clear winds. That is why trains from Kathmandu to treacherous mountain airstrips such as Lukla are much more manageable. In addition, the Lukla flights October are often less subject to weather cancellations than during the summer or spring seasons.
